Processing Warehouse Receipt with License Plates

Article07/10/20244 min read

You can perform the Receive activity on the Aptean Mobile Warehouse Registration app by manually entering or scanning the Warehouse Receipt Number. You can process Warehouse Receipt on Purchase Order or Sales Return Order using the following steps:

  1. Select the Receive icon on the Aptean Mobile Warehouse Registration home screen.
  2. Enter the PO/Trans/WMS No.
  3. Enter or scan Item No.
  4. If the item is License Plate tracked, the app notifies you to enter or scan the License Plate for the Item. The Qty. to Recv., and Qty. Recv. are filled in automatically with the quantity to receive and quantity received, respectively if the Show Qty. to Receive and Show Qty. Received options are set to Yes, in the Mobile Profile Setup page when the Page field is set with RECEIPT.
  5. Scan the barcode on the item that contains the License Plate number.

Alternatively, you can enter the License Plate number manually by typing it in the Item Identifier.

The License Plate number can also be assigned automatically using the function New License Plate.

Note

When the Aptean SSCC extension is installed and the Use SSCC Number Format toggle on the Item Tracking Code page in Business central is turned on, the license plate number is generated based on the settings of the Company SSCC Setup page.

This new License Plate number is generated based on the number series set up in the License Plate Nos. field on the License Plate Setup page.

The app notifies you to scan the Shipping Container for the scanned License Plate. It is checked whether the Default Packaging from the Aptean Food & Beverage Packaging extension corresponds to the warehouse receipt line (based on Item No., Vendor Number and Order Address). If this is the case, the Shipping Container Code will be automatically registered.

  1. In case multiple or no default packaging exists for the Item which is applicable to the warehouse receipt line, you must manually enter or scan the Shipping Container Code.
    You can only enter a code that has been set up in the Aptean Food & Beverage Packaging extension as a shipping container.
  2. In case theShipping Container Code was not entered or scanned due to the Default Packaging, you can overwrite the automatically assigned Shipping Container Code by scanning or manually entering a Shipping Container Code in this step.
    Enter or scan the Lot No.
  3. Enter the Qty. Handled field with the quantity to receive in the base unit of measure. The entered quantity is then received. A Mobile Scan Entry is created automatically with the scanned values in Business Central.
  4. Select the AssistEdit button and select Post to post the warehouse receipt. The Location Code and Bin Code are updated on the Mobile Scan Entry page in Business Central.
  5. On the Warehouse Receipt page, on the action bar, Select Process > Transfer Scan Data.

The status of Mobile Scan Entry is changed to Transferred. The License Plate No., Lot No., and Quantity data are moved to the Item Tracking Lines for the respective Warehouse Receipt Line.

Note
  • You cannot enter a License Plate that is already used in a pending Mobile Scan Entry and linked to another document number other than the current Warehouse Receipt.
  • You cannot enter a License Plate that already contains an inventory in Business Central.

Transfer from a non-License Plate tracked location to a License Plate tracked location

When transferring a license plate-tracked item from a non-license plate tracked location to a license plate tracked location, a newLicense Plate number must be created when receiving the items.

To handle the warehouse receipt for the transfer order, see Processing Warehouse Receipt on License Plate.

When executing Transfer Scan Entries, the newly created license plate numbers will be transferred to the Change License Plate Nos. page.

On the Item Tracking Lines page, on the action bar, click Action > Functions > Change License Plate Nos. to review the license plate numbers and if necessary, to adjust.

For more information, see To transfer items from a ‘Non-License Plate required’ location to a ‘License Plate-required’ location in the License Plating extension.

Note

It is not possible to place multiple lot numbers on one license plate when transferring a license plate-tracked item from a non-license plate tracked location to a license plate tracked location. You must enter a new license plate for each lot number that will be received.
